Transaction 37405c46d0ff524123932f590f9c33fcb1fe77e2fe9f22f731f45695a286e90c

1 Input
2 Outputs
  • 37405c46d0ff524123932f590f9c33fcb1fe77e2fe9f22f731f45695a286e90c:0
  • value  128557
    address  3PSKPJn7cKdumzzYF7xDEdCbDEpMg876EE
  • 37405c46d0ff524123932f590f9c33fcb1fe77e2fe9f22f731f45695a286e90c:1
  • value  2740000
    address  3G4qXhYpxtNq39pmBdWTyXN58eQ2Lm8k3g